站群服務(wù)器出現(xiàn)卡頓通常由多重因素疊加導(dǎo)致,需從硬件資源、軟件配置、網(wǎng)絡(luò)環(huán)境、安全威脅及管理維護(hù)等維度深度排查。以下是具體原因分析及對(duì)應(yīng)排查方向:
原因:
站群承載多站點(diǎn)并發(fā)請(qǐng)求,若 CPU 核心數(shù)不足或頻率過低,高頻計(jì)算(如 PHP 解析、數(shù)據(jù)庫(kù)查詢)會(huì)導(dǎo)致 CPU 占用率長(zhǎng)期超過 80%,出現(xiàn)任務(wù)隊(duì)列堆積。
排查:
top
或htop
命令查看 CPU 使用率,重點(diǎn)關(guān)注%us
(用戶空間)和%sy
(系統(tǒng)空間)占比,若持續(xù)高于 70% 則需擴(kuò)容。
原因:
排查:
mysqldumpslow
分析慢查詢?nèi)罩荆?code style="-webkit-font-smoothing: antialiased; box-sizing: border-box; -webkit-tap-highlight-color: rgba(0, 0, 0, 0); background: var(--color-inline-code-background); border-radius: 4px; color: var(--color-text-primary); font-size: 14px; font-family: Menlo, Monaco, Consolas, "Courier New", monospace; overflow-anchor: auto;">EXPLAIN語(yǔ)句檢查 SQL 執(zhí)行計(jì)劃,啟用query_cache_size
或部署 Redis 緩存。
實(shí)時(shí)監(jiān)控資源:top
+htop
查看 CPU / 內(nèi)存,iftop
+iostat
監(jiān)控網(wǎng)絡(luò) / 磁盤。
分析錯(cuò)誤日志:重點(diǎn)看 Web 服務(wù)(Nginx/Apache)、數(shù)據(jù)庫(kù)(MySQL)日志中的異常報(bào)錯(cuò)。
流量清洗與攔截:若確認(rèn) DDoS/CC 攻擊,啟用高防 IP 或 WAF 的智能攔截規(guī)則。
分批隔離測(cè)試:暫停部分站點(diǎn),定位卡頓是否與特定站點(diǎn)相關(guān)。
通過以上維度逐步排查,可快速定位站群卡頓的核心原因,后續(xù)結(jié)合硬件升級(jí)、軟件優(yōu)化及安全防護(hù)措施,提升服務(wù)器穩(wěn)定性。
(聲明:本文來源于網(wǎng)絡(luò),僅供參考閱讀,涉及侵權(quán)請(qǐng)聯(lián)系我們刪除、不代表任何立場(chǎng)以及觀點(diǎn)。)